The Flintstones Season 1 Episode 19
To commemorate his tenth wedding anniversary (which he only remembers because it falls on “”Trash Day””), Fred wants to buy Wilma a Stoneway piano. He finds a hot deal–ultimately too hot–from a shady, cash-only businessman named 88 Fingers Louie.
Serie: The Flintstones
Episode Title: The Hot Piano
Air Date: 1961-02-03
